The Paul Biancardi college style practice came back to Randolph-Macon college this year and had a great group of prospects from 6 different states and all classes in attendance. He did a great session of drill work, transition play, 3-on-3 and 5-on-5 games and there were plenty of players who stood out. Here's a look at part 1 of some of the standouts.
